अंतरिक्षे गृहं तस्य गधर्वनगरं शुभम् । यौवनस्थाः सुरूपाश्च कन्या गन्धर्वजाः शुभाः
aṃtarikṣe gṛhaṃ tasya gadharvanagaraṃ śubham | yauvanasthāḥ surūpāśca kanyā gandharvajāḥ śubhāḥ
ومسكنه في الفضاء بين السماء والأرض—مدينةٌ بهيّة مباركة للغندرفا. وفيها فتياتٌ مولوداتٌ من الغندرفا، ذواتُ يمنٍ، في ريعان الشباب وحسنِ الصورة.

Scene: A splendid Gandharva city suspended in mid-air; youthful, beautiful Gandharva maidens dwell there, auspicious and radiant.
The Purāṇas depict layered worlds (lokas) to emphasize that dharma and order extend beyond the human realm into celestial societies.
No terrestrial tīrtha is specified; the verse describes a celestial Gandharva-nagara in antarikṣa.
